前言 javascript中,函数不介意传递进来多少参数,也不在乎传进来的参数什么数据类型,甚至不传参数。 javascript中的函数定义未指定函数形参的类型,函数调用也不会对传入的实参值做任何类型检查。同名形参 非严格模式下,函数中可以出现同名形参,只能访问最后出现的该名称的形参。在严格模式下,抛出语法错误。 1 function add(x,x,x){
2 return x;
转载
2023-10-18 20:44:46
305阅读
# JavaScript 中函数多参数的实现方法
在 JavaScript 中,函数可以接收多个参数。这对于开发者来说是一个非常实用的功能,尤其是在需要处理来自用户的输入或处理多项数据时。本文将介绍如何在 JavaScript 中实现函数多参数,帮助你从基础理解到实际应用。
## 整体流程
我们可以通过以下步骤来实现和理解 JavaScript 中函数的多参数:
| 步骤 | 内容
js的传递多个参数和c#的有所不同,js需要再每个参数用单引号来分开,例如:<a href=javascript:Show('arg0','arg1','arg2','arg3')>修改</a> 相应的js代码:function Show(arg0,arg1,arg2,arg3)
{} 不太清楚为什么在调用的时候要加单引号分开呢,可能就是不同编程语言的区别了~
转载
2023-06-09 15:27:34
223阅读
JavaScript函数参数传值问题首先先上个结论,在JavaScript中函数只有值传递,没有引用传递。1.向参数传递基本数据类型基本数据类型包括number、string这些。那么当传入这些基本类型时,是否可以通过形参来修改呢? EXP:var num = 123
function text(a){
a = 1
console.log(a) //1
}
text(num)
转载
2023-07-05 23:33:27
209阅读
设置全局变量。 找到.properties文件:在文件中设置值:在kettle中新建一个job(不用做任何设置):转换中获取便元的设置:重启kettle的执行结果:
转载
2023-06-09 23:12:48
315阅读
形式参数和实际参数
形式参数:函数定义需要添加的参数
实际参数:调用函数时,传递到函数的参数
转载
2020-11-06 15:49:00
58阅读
ECMA-262标准没有参照浏览器,那么它都规定了哪些内容呢?大致来说,它规定了这门语言的组成部分: 语法 类型 语句 关键字 保留字 操作符 对象 ECMAScript就是对实现这个标准规定的语言的描述,JavaScript的核心就是ECMAScript,也就是说JavaScript实现了ECMAScript。理解参数 ECMAScript函数不介意传递进来几个参数,也不在乎传进来的参数是什么数
转载
2023-07-09 20:48:27
24阅读
function getPoint()
{
var a = new Object();
a.x = 1;
a.y = 2;
return a;
}
转载
2023-06-06 10:12:51
131阅读
定义支持多值参数的函数有时需要一个函数能够处理参数个数不确定,这是需要使用多值参数。Python中有两种多值参数:参数名前增加一个 * 可以接收元组参数名前增加一个 ** 可以接收字典 【多值参数传递】def demo(num, *nums, **person):
print(num)
print(nums)
print(person)
demo(1)
pri
转载
2023-05-18 11:03:17
193阅读
学习器模型中一般有两类参数,一类是可以从数据中学习估计得到,还有一类参数时无法从数据中估计,只能靠人的经验进行设计指定,后者成为超参数。比如,支持向量机里面的C, Kernal, game;朴素贝叶斯里面的alpha等。使用以下的方法获得学习器模型的参数列表和当前取值, estimator.get_params()参数空间的搜索有以下几个部分构成:一个estimator(回归器 or 分类器)一个
转载
2024-05-09 10:19:12
42阅读
初识函数一、函数的定义函数的定义由以下4部分组成:关键字function、函数名、参数、函数体定义命名函数function funcName(参数列表){
statements
[return [expr]];
}
function sayHi(name,message){
alert("hello"+name+","+message);
}二、参数设
转载
2023-12-16 21:41:05
153阅读
文章目录使用表达式作为默认值示例 1:将参数作为默认值传递示例 2:将函数值作为默认值传递传递 undefined 值参考文档 在本教程中,您将借助示例了解 JavaScript 默认参数。 默认参数的概念是 ES6 版本的 JavaScript 中引入的一个新特性。这允许我们为函数参数提供默认值。我们举个例子,function sum(x = 3, y = 5) {
转载
2023-05-23 16:52:43
109阅读
在JavaScript中,函数的参数有以下几种:1. 普通参数(Positional Parameters):这是最常见的函数参数类型,定义时在函数括号内指定参数名称即可。调用函数时需要传入相应的参数值,按照定义时的顺序对应传入。例如:```
javascriptCopy code
function greet(name, message) {
con
转载
2023-08-20 14:33:36
577阅读
1、前言在控制器类的方法里自己写校验逻辑代码当然也可以,只是代码比较丑陋,有点“low”。业界有更好的处理方法,分别阐述如下。2、PathVariable校验@GetMapping("/path/{group:[a-zA-Z0-9_]+}/{userid}")
@ResponseBody
public String path(@PathVariable("group") String group,
转载
2023-08-22 16:22:23
105阅读
本文内容大多基于官方文档和网上前辈经验总结,经过个人实践加以整理积累,仅供参考。Java 1.5 引入了 Varargs 机制(Variable number of arguments,可变参数)可变参数特点:1 一个方法中只能定义一个可变参数2 如果方法中包含多个参数,可变参数必须位于参数列表最后3 调用可变参数的方法时,编译器将可变参数隐式转化为一个数组,在方法中以数组方式访问可变参数,如pu
转载
2024-03-04 17:46:14
48阅读
Edit: 在我入职上一家公司的第一天,看到代码库里面一堆的 for 循环,内心有些崩溃,于是做了一次技术分享,展示怎样在代码中避免 for 循环。这篇文章是那次分享的总结。至于为什么我提倡避免 for 循环,参考我写的这篇文章。本文并不完美,其中递归的部分其实不应该在生产环境中用的。重点其实应该是怎样用 reduce 和其它高阶函数,至于这些高阶函数底层用的是 while 循环还是 for 循环
转载
2024-06-20 09:58:26
40阅读
Javascript 中 Function 的属性与方法1. Function 构造函数的属性与方法1. Function.arguments (不建议使用)代表传入函数的实参,是一个类数组对象,这个属性已经废弃,当前普遍使用的是:在 函数中直接使用 arguments 对象,如果使用 es6 建议使用 ... 操作符获取传入实参function a(arg1, arg2) {
conso
转载
2023-11-23 13:56:52
202阅读
壹 ❀ 引在JavaScript开发中,条件判断语句的使用频率是极高的,而对于条件判断简单易读的if else应该都是大家的首选。可是代码写的久了,我们总是希望自己的代码看着能更为简洁规范(逼格更高),那么今天我们就由浅到深介绍几种实用小技巧,帮大家减少代码中的if else。说在开头,本文并未有消灭或歧视 if else的意思,if else的好用都知道,这里只是在某些特定场景为大家
JavaScript 函数参数JavaScript 函数对参数的值没有进行任何的检查。函数显式参数(Parameters)与隐式参数(Arguments)functionName(parameter1, parameter2, parameter3) {
// 要执行的代码……
}函数显式参数在函数定义时列出。函数隐式参数在函数调用时传递给函数真正的值。参数规则JavaScrip
转载
2023-12-25 10:37:12
65阅读
java的基本功能实现可变参数是传递
原创
2012-06-29 11:30:16
543阅读